Présentation

Built in 1518, the arsenal consists of three buildings. First called Zeughaus, it eventually took the name of Saint-Hilaire in 1785 when it was transformed by the commander of the artillery of the town : Marc Gaspard de Saint-Hilaire. The arsenal sheltered several thousand pioneerstools, lead, tar and ammunition. The impressive timber frame with its three levels of tiled-floor attics is an evidence of the former storage function of the building.
